12-02 · Facility Environment
The facility was observed with wet and broken ceiling tile in the infant room. All childcare facilities must be clean, in good repair, free from health and safety hazards and from evidence of, or presence of, vermin infestation. Indoor play areas must be inspected daily for basic health and safety and documented on a daily inspection log. Outdoor play areas must be inspected daily for basic health and safety. Any problems must be corrected before the play area is used by children. Documentation of the indoor play area inspection must be maintained for 12 months. Please replace ceiling tile. Once completed send a picture via email to the licensing office by June 15, 2025

32-07 · Outdoor Equipment
The resilient surface under the large playground structure and the two metal cars in the preschool playground was insufficient. Provider will add additional sand to achieve a minimum depth of 6 inches under the equipment in question and send pictures to the licensing office via email by 7/15/24. DCF Handboock 1. If the ground cover in place is loose ground cover (such as, but not limited to: mulch, shredded rubber chips, or sand) a minimum of 6 inches in depth is required in the use zone. Asphalt, concrete, hard packed dirt, hay, grass or leaves are unsuitable for use in the use zone area. 13.12 Outdoor Equipment D. [...]All types of ground cover must be maintained to provide resilience and reduce the incidence of injuries to children in the event of falls
